Course structure

• Introduction to Sustainable Materials
• Life Cycle Assessment
• Circular Economy Principles
• Material Selection and Design
• Renewable Material Technologies
• Waste Management and Recycling
• Environmental Impact of Materials
• Sustainable Manufacturing Processes
• Policy and Regulation in Sustainability
• Case Studies in Sustainable Materials

Career path

```html
career roles key responsibilities
sustainable materials engineer develop eco-friendly materials, optimize production processes, ensure compliance with sustainability standards
materials research scientist conduct research on sustainable materials, analyze material properties, publish findings
product development specialist design sustainable products, collaborate with cross-functional teams, test prototypes
environmental compliance officer monitor environmental regulations, ensure adherence to sustainability policies, conduct audits
supply chain sustainability manager oversee sustainable sourcing, manage supplier relationships, reduce carbon footprint
recycling and waste management consultant develop waste reduction strategies, advise on recycling technologies, implement circular economy practices
green building materials specialist recommend sustainable construction materials, ensure energy efficiency, support green building certifications
